According to the Independent Journal Review, John F. Kennedy was the wealthiest man ever sworn into the presidency, and gave his presidential salary to charity once he got into the White House (he did the same with his congressional salary). On September 24, 1789, Congress voted to pay the president $25,000 per year and the vice president $5,000 per year.
